Bespoke Fitted Wardrobes

Made-to-measure wardrobes for any room

Made-to-measure timber wardrobes designed around your storage. Floor-to-ceiling, wall-to-wall, walk-in, sliding, hinged or a mix — we'll plan the internal layout (hanging rails, drawers, shoe racks, shelves) around what you actually own, then build and install the doors and frames.

Ideal for

Property suitability

Master bedrooms and dressing rooms where floor-to-ceiling fitted storage will make better use of the space than freestanding wardrobes. Especially effective in awkward eaves, alcoves and L-shaped rooms.

Installation

How we fit it

Most wardrobe installations take 2–4 days on site after workshop build. We'll protect carpets and floors, and the room is usable each evening.

How long does it take from first call to installation? +
A typical project takes 6โ€“12 weeks from initial site visit to install. Survey and design happen in week 1; manufacture in our workshop takes the bulk of the time; installation is usually a few days on site. Larger projects or specialist timber may take longer โ€” we'll be honest about timings at the quote stage.
